MultipleViewPattern Klass

Definition

Representerar kontroller som tillhandahåller och kan växla mellan flera representationer av samma uppsättning information eller underordnade kontroller.

public ref class MultipleViewPattern : System::Windows::Automation::BasePattern
public class MultipleViewPattern : System.Windows.Automation.BasePattern
type MultipleViewPattern = class
    inherit BasePattern
Public Class MultipleViewPattern
Inherits BasePattern
Arv
MultipleViewPattern

Kommentarer

Exempel på kontroller som kan visa flera vyer är listvyn (som kan visa innehållet som miniatyrbilder, paneler, ikoner eller information), Microsoft Excel diagram (cirkel, linje, stapel, cellvärde med en formel), Microsoft Word dokument (normal, webblayout, utskriftslayout, läslayout, disposition), Outlook kalender (år, månad, vecka, dag) och Microsoft Windows Media Player skinn. De vyer som stöds bestäms av kontrollutvecklaren och är specifika för varje kontroll.

Fält

Name Description
CurrentViewProperty

Identifierar egenskapen CurrentView .

Pattern

Identifierar MultipleViewPattern kontrollmönstret.

SupportedViewsProperty

Identifierar egenskapen som hämtar den kontrollspecifika samlingen med vyer.

Egenskaper

Name Description
Cached

Hämtar cachelagrade UI Automation egenskapsvärden för den här MultipleViewPattern.

Current

Hämtar aktuella UI Automation egenskapsvärden för den här MultipleViewPattern.

Metoder

Name Description
Equals(Object)

Avgör om det angivna objektet är lika med det aktuella objektet.

(Ärvd från Object)
GetHashCode()

Fungerar som standard-hash-funktion.

(Ärvd från Object)
GetType()

Hämtar den aktuella instansen Type .

(Ärvd från Object)
GetViewName(Int32)

Hämtar namnet på en kontrollspecifik vy.

MemberwiseClone()

Skapar en ytlig kopia av den aktuella Object.

(Ärvd från Object)
SetCurrentView(Int32)

Anger den aktuella kontrollspecifika vyn.

ToString()

Returnerar en sträng som representerar det aktuella objektet.

(Ärvd från Object)

Gäller för

Se även